Fixes smiles, writes books: Orthodontist publishes children’s book

By BRUCE COLLIER

Orthodontist Dr. Casi B. Stubbs, D.M.D, maintains two offices, in Niceville and Destin. As if that were not enough work, the DeFuniak Springs native has embarked on a new sideline – children’s books. Her first is titled This Will Be & You Will See, which Stubbs dedicated to her daughters Elle (age 7) and Brycelyn (age 3).

Stubbs, who admits she has no writing background either academic or practical, was moved to write the book by her reflections on “passages in life as we continue to grow.” She wanted to make her daughters part of the story, to tell them what they can expect out of life and the challenges of growing up. “It was a gift to them,” she says. “I just felt passionate about it. If I didn’t try it, it was going to follow me.”

Stubbs wrote the book in 2011. A chance meeting at a party in south Walton took the story to the next level. Stubbs found herself in conversation with Tami Hotard, owner of New Orleans-based Liberty Press. Stubbs mentioned she had written a children’s book and Hotard expressed interest in its publication.

For the artwork, Stubbs took her time and selected a local artist, Gina Ricci, whose illustrations set the book in the CR-30A/Blue Mountain/Santa Rosa Beach area where Stubbs had spent her childhood summers. A year after the meeting with Hotard, Liberty Press had published the book.

This Will Be & You Will See has received favorable response, and Stubbs says that many readers find themselves moved by it. She has done some area book-signings, and the book has been placed at Sundog Books in Seaside and Hidden Lantern in Rosemary Beach. It should be at Barnes & Noble by Mothers Day, and on Amazon soon.

Stubbs has two more books in preparation for publication in 2014. One is a “strong Christian book” on the story of Jesus. The other, “inspired by my patients,” is about going through “that little awkward stage” of growth, and learning to accept one’s appearance. She credits her husband Zachary with support all along the way. “He encourages me. He’s my cheerleader.”
